Yahoo! Calendar "Add Event" Seed URL Parameters

I can't seem to find any official documentation on this, so here are my notes. Some information gathered from  http://richmarr.wordpress.com/tag/calendar/ Other information gathered through trial and error, and close examination of the "Add Event" form on Yahoo!'s site. Yahoo! Calendar URL Parameters Parameter Required Example Value Notes v Required 60 Must be  60 . Possibly a version number? TITLE Required Event title Line feeds will appear in the confirmation screen, but will not be saved. May not contain HTML. ST Required 20090514T180000Z Event start time in UTC. Will be converted to the user's time zone. 20090514T180000 Event start time in user's local time 20090514 Event start time for an all day event. DUR value is ignored if this form is used. Java Identifiers

Language Fundamentals Java Identifiers: A name in a java Program is called an Identifier, Which can be used for representing classes, methods, variables and labels. Rules: 1. Java Identifier is composed of a sequence of characters, where each character may be a   ASCII Latin letters A–Z(\u0041–\u005a), and a–z (\u0061–\u007a) and for historical reasons , the ASCII underscore (_, or \u005f) and dollar sign ($, or \u0024) and ASCII digits 0-9 (\u0030–\u0039). i.e A-Z,a-z,_,$,0-9 The $ character should be used only in mechanically generated source code or, rarely, to access pre-existing names on legacy systems. If we use other character we will get compiled time error saying illegal character. 2. No identifier starts with the digit. 3. There is no length limit for java identifier, but SUN highly recommended up to 15 characters. 4. Identifiers in java are case sensitive. 5. Spring boot basics

  Spring Boot is a powerful framework that simplifies the development of enterprise-grade applications by providing a pre-configured setup that allows developers to focus more on writing business logic rather than managing configuration. In this post, we’ll dive into the architecture flow of a typical Spring Boot application, helping you understand how the components interact and how requests are processed from start to finish. 1. The Core Components of Spring Boot Architecture Before we delve into the flow, it’s essential to understand the core components that make up a Spring Boot application: Spring Framework : The backbone of Spring Boot, providing dependency injection, AOP, and transaction management. Embedded Server : Spring Boot applications usually run with an embedded server (Tomcat, Jetty, or Undertow), making them self-contained and easy to deploy.
